Serowe police are investigating the suspected suicide of a 34-year-old man who committed the act while he and his girlfriend were home at Mothaka lands on the outskirts of Mmashoro village.

Officer Commanding No 2 District, Senior Superintendent Paul Oketsang said they received a report from the couple's neighbour.

"The couple's neighbour said she was busy removing weeds from her crops when she heard a scream from the deceased's girlfriend. She was crying and rushed to them," "The reporter said on arrival she found the deceased's girlfriend crying with her boyfriend hanging from the roof rafters and reported the matter to the police."
